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
PQTest bietet eine Reihe von Befehlen mit jeweils eigenen Optionen, um Ihren Testprozess zu optimieren. Ausführliche Erläuterungen und Verwendungsanweisungen für diese Befehle sind in den folgenden Abschnitten beschrieben.
Befehle
In der folgenden Tabelle sind alle Befehle für PQTest.exeaufgeführt:
| Command | Description |
|---|---|
| Credential-Template | Generiert eine Vorlage zum Festlegen von Datenquellenanmeldeinformationen. |
| vergleichen | Führt PQ (Testdatei) aus und vergleicht die Ergebnisse mit PQOut (Testausgabedatei). Wenn die Testausgabedatei nicht vorhanden ist, wird sie automatisch für Sie generiert. |
| Anmeldeinformationen löschen | Löscht Anmeldeinformationen aus dem Anmeldeinformationsspeicher. |
| discover | Gibt Ergebnisse der Datenquellenermittlung für einen bestimmten Ausdruck zurück. |
| info | Gibt alle Erweiterungsmodulinformationen zurück. |
| Listenanmeldeinformationen | Gibt alle Anmeldeinformationen im Anmeldespeicher zurück. |
| oauth | Zeigt OAuth-Clientinformationen für einen bestimmten Ausdruck oder eine datenquelle an. |
| Refresh-Credential | Erneuert OAuth-Anmeldeinformationen im Anmeldedatenspeicher. |
| Ausführungs-Test | Führt Tests aus und gibt die Ergebnisse zurück. |
| Set-Credential | Legt eine Anmeldeinformation fest und speichert sie im Anmeldeinformationsspeicher. |
| Testverbindung | Führt einen TestConnection-Aufruf für einen bestimmten Connector aus. |
| validate | Überprüft die TestConnection-Implementierung des Connectors. |
| Ausgabe | Gibt Produktversionsinformationen zurück. |
Options
In der folgenden Tabelle sind alle Optionen für PQTest.exe Befehle aufgeführt:
| Option | Abbr. | Description |
|---|---|---|
| --Hilfe | -?/-h | Zeigt Hilfeinformationen für Befehle und Optionen an. |
| --authenticationKind | -Ak | Gibt die Authentifizierungsart an (Anonym, UsernamePassword, Key, Windows, OAuth2). |
| --applicationProperty | -AP | Einstellung einzelner Anwendungseigenschaften (Schlüssel=Wert-Format). |
| --applicationPropertyFile | -apf | Pfad zur Anwendungseigenschaftendatei. |
| --diagnosticChannels | -dc | Liste der Diagnosekanäle, die für die Mashup-Verbindung abonniert werden sollen (derzeit unterstützt: Odbc). |
| --dataSourceKind | -dsk | Datenquellentyp. |
| --dataSourcePath | -dsp | Datenquellenpfad. |
| --environmentConfiguration | -EG | Konfigurationseinstellung für eine einzelne Umgebung (im Key=Wert-Format). |
| --environmentConfigurationFile | -ecf | Pfad zur Umgebungskonfigurationsdatei. |
| --Erweiterung | -e | Angeben von Quellmodulen für Connectorerweiterungen (.mez/.pqx). Diese Option kann mehrmals angegeben werden. |
| --failOnFoldingFailure | -foff | Repliziert das DirectQuery-Verhalten, indem ein Fehler auftritt, wenn eine Abfrage nicht vollständig gefaltet wird. |
| --failOnMissingOutputFile | -fomof | Vergleich generiert keine PQOut-Datei und schlägt fehl, wenn sie nicht vorhanden ist. |
| --interaktiv | Benutzerinteraktion zulassen (z. B. Authentifizierung). | |
| --keyVault | -Kv | Verwenden Sie Azure Key Vault für die Speicherung von Anmeldeinformationen mit dem angegebenen geheimen Namen. |
| --logMashupEngineTraces | -l | Protokollierung aktivieren. Zulässige Werte sind: all | user | engine. |
| --parameterQueryFile | -pa | Parameterabfrage-Datei, die einen M-Ausdruck (.m/.pq) enthält, der auf die Testdaten in der Datenquelle zeigt. |
| --prettyPrint | -p | Geben Sie die Erweiterung der JSON-Ausgabe im Registerkartenformat an, die einfacher lesbar ist. |
| --queryFile | -q | Abfragedatei, die ein Abschnittsdokument oder einen M-Ausdruck (.m/.pq) enthält. |
| --settingsFile | -Sf | Pfad zur JSON-Einstellungsdatei mit Konfigurationen für Testläufe. |
| --trxReportPath | -trx | Generiert eine TRX-Ergebnisdatei (Visual Studio Test Results File) und separate JSON-Dateien für jeden Test in einem bestimmten Pfad. |
| --useLegacyBrowser | Verwenden Sie legacy browser control (IE11) für interaktiven OAuth-Fluss (anstelle von Microsoft Edge Chromium/Webview2). | |
| --useSystemBrowser | Verwenden Sie den Systembrowser für den interaktiven OAuth-Fluss. |